Why Back Short-Term Rental Associations? These associations play a key role in promoting fair regulations that consider both local community needs and property owner rights. Their efforts focus on:

  • Protecting property rights: Associations advocate for property owners, ensuring that local governments don't pass laws that unfairly restrict or prohibit short-term rentals.
  • Providing resources and education: Many associations offer tools, educational content, and legal support to help vacation rental owners manage their businesses effectively.
  • Strengthening your voice: Supporting these groups aligns you with a broader effort to influence legislation and policies that shape the future of your rental business.

Empowering Owners and Property Managers Successfully running a short-term rental involves more than just delivering a great guest experience—it also requires responsible business practices. Here’s how you can keep your business thriving and compliant:

  • Stay informed: Keep track of local and state laws affecting short-term rentals, as they can change. Staying proactive helps you avoid potential fines or penalties.
  • Be a good neighbor: Make sure your guests understand local rules on noise, parking, and other community guidelines. This fosters positive relationships with your neighbors.
  • Support industry associations: By joining your state's vacation rental association, you stay informed and help protect your rights as a rental owner or property manager.

State Associations to Support We encourage you to get involved with vacation rental associations in your state. These organizations are at the forefront of defending the short-term rental industry:

  • Wisconsin: Wisconsin Short Term Rental Alliance (WISTRA)
  • Michigan: Michigan Short Term Rental Association (MISTRA)
  • Minnesota: Minnesota STR Owners Association (MNSTRA)
  • Tennessee: Tennessee Vacation Rental Owners Association (TVROA)
  • Oklahoma: Oklahoma Short Term Rental Alliance (OKSTRA)
  • Montana: Montana Vacation Rental Owners Association (MTVRO)
  • Kentucky: Kentucky STR Alliance (KYSTRA)
  • Texas: Texas Short Term Rental Alliance (TXSTRA)
  • Alabama: Alabama Vacation Rental Owners Association (ALVROA)
  • New York: New York State Vacation Rental Association (NYSVRA)
  • North Carolina: North Carolina Vacation Rental Association (NCVRA)
  • Colorado: Colorado Association of Vacation Rentals (CAVR)
